Generally speaking, Orange G migrates faster than bromophenol blue, which migrates faster than xylene cyanol, but the apparent " sizes " of these dyes ( compared to DNA molecules ) varies with the concentration of agarose and the buffer system used.

For instance, in a 1 % agarose gel made in TAE buffer ( Tris-acetate-EDTA ), xylene cyanol migrates at the speed of a 3000 base pair ( bp ) molecule of DNA and bromophenol blue migrates at 400 bp.
